Definition
Noun: * Aesthetics: The branch of philosophy concerned with the nature of beauty, art, and taste, and with the creation and appreciation of beauty. It studies the principles and effects of beauty on human perception and emotion.

Advanced Usage
- "thẩm mỹ học môi trường": environmental aesthetics. This subfield examines the aesthetic appreciation of natural and human-made environments.
- "thẩm mỹ học ứng dụng": applied aesthetics. This refers to the application of aesthetic theory to specific fields like design, architecture, or cosmetics.

Related Concepts
- Cái đẹp: Beauty. This is the central object of study in aesthetics.
- Nghệ thuật: Art. A primary domain for the application and discussion of aesthetic principles.
- Cảm thụ nghệ thuật: Art appreciation. This involves the perception and judgment influenced by aesthetic understanding.
